How to Make the Perfect Grilled Shrimp Tacos

Grilled shrimp tacos are a delicious and healthy meal that can be enjoyed any time of the year. They are easy to make and can be customized to suit your taste preferences. In this article, we will provide you with a step-by-step guide on how to make the perfect grilled shrimp tacos.

Ingredients:

– 1 pound of shrimp, peeled and deveined
– 1 tablespoon of olive oil
– 1 teaspoon of chili powder
– 1 teaspoon of cumin
– 1/2 teaspoon of garlic powder
– Salt and pepper to taste
– 8-10 corn tortillas
– 1 cup of shredded cabbage
– 1/2 cup of diced tomatoes
– 1/4 cup of chopped cilantro
– 1 lime, cut into wedges

Instructions:

1.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.

2. In a small bowl, mix together the olive oil, chili powder, cumin,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.

3. Add the shrimp to the bowl and toss to coat evenly.

4. Thread the shrimp onto skewers, making sure to leave a little space between each shrimp.

5. Place the skewers on the grill and cook for 2-3 minutes on each side, or until the shrimp are pink and cooked through.

6. While the shrimp are cooking, warm the tortillas on the grill for 30 seconds on each side.

7. To assemble the tacos, place a few pieces of shrimp on each tortilla, followed by some shredded cabbage, diced tomatoes, and chopped cilantro.

8. Squeeze a wedge of lime over each taco before serving.

Tips:

– If you don’t have a grill, you can also cook the shrimp in a skillet on the stove over medium-high heat.

– To prevent the tortillas from sticking to the grill, brush them with a little bit of oil before warming them up.

– You can also add other toppings to your tacos, such as avocado, salsa, or sour cream.

– If you’re short on time, you can use pre-cooked shrimp instead of raw shrimp. Just warm them up on the grill for a minute or two on each side.

The Health Benefits of Grilled Shrimp Tacos

Grilled shrimp tacos are a delicious and healthy meal option that can be enjoyed by anyone. Not only are they packed with flavor, but they also offer a range of health benefits that make them a great addition to any diet.

One of the main benefits of grilled shrimp tacos is their high protein content. Shrimp is a great source of lean protein, which is essential for building and repairing muscle tissue. This makes grilled shrimp tacos an ideal meal for athletes or anyone looking to increase their protein intake.

In addition to protein, shrimp is also a good source of omega-3 fatty acids. These healthy fats are important for maintaining heart health and reducing inflammation in the body. By incorporating grilled shrimp tacos into your diet, you can help to reduce your risk of heart disease and other chronic illnesses.

Another benefit of grilled shrimp tacos is their low calorie count. Shrimp is a low calorie food, which means that you can enjoy a satisfying meal without consuming too many calories. This makes grilled shrimp tacos a great option for anyone looking to lose weight or maintain a healthy weight.

Grilled shrimp tacos are also a good source of vitamins and minerals. Shrimp contains a range of essential nutrients, including vitamin B12, iron, and zinc. These nutrients are important for maintaining a healthy immune system, promoting healthy skin and hair, and supporting overall health and wellbeing.

When it comes to preparing grilled shrimp tacos, there are a few things to keep in mind to ensure that they are as healthy as possible. First, it is important to choose high quality shrimp that is sustainably sourced. Look for shrimp that is wild caught and avoid shrimp that has been farmed using antibiotics or other harmful chemicals.

When grilling shrimp, it is important to avoid using too much oil or butter. Instead, try using a non-stick cooking spray or a small amount of olive oil to prevent the shrimp from sticking to the grill. You can also add flavor to your grilled shrimp tacos by using a range of herbs and spices, such as cumin, chili powder, and garlic.

To make your grilled shrimp tacos even healthier, try using whole grain tortillas instead of white flour tortillas. Whole grain tortillas are a good source of fiber, which can help to promote healthy digestion and reduce the risk of chronic diseases such as diabetes and heart disease.

A Guide to Pairing Wine with Grilled Shrimp Tacos

Grilled shrimp tacos are a delicious and healthy meal that can be enjoyed any time of the year. They are easy to make and can be customized to suit your taste preferences. Whether you prefer a spicy or mild flavor, grilled shrimp tacos are a great option for a quick and satisfying meal.

When it comes to pairing wine with grilled shrimp tacos, there are a few things to consider. The first thing to consider is the flavor profile of the dish. Grilled shrimp tacos are typically seasoned with a variety of spices, including cumin, chili powder, and garlic. These flavors can be complemented by a variety of wines, including white, red, and rosé.

If you prefer white wine, a crisp and refreshing Sauvignon Blanc is a great option. This wine has a bright acidity that pairs well with the citrus flavors in the dish. Another great option is a dry Riesling, which has a slightly sweet flavor that can balance out the spiciness of the dish.

For those who prefer red wine, a light-bodied Pinot Noir is a great option. This wine has a delicate flavor that won’t overpower the flavors of the dish. Another great option is a Zinfandel, which has a bold flavor that can stand up to the spiciness of the dish.

If you prefer rosé, a dry rosé is a great option. This wine has a light and refreshing flavor that pairs well with the grilled shrimp. Another great option is a sparkling rosé, which has a crisp and refreshing flavor that can complement the flavors of the dish.

When it comes to serving temperature, it’s important to serve white wine chilled and red wine at room temperature. Rosé can be served chilled or at room temperature, depending on your preference.

In addition to wine, there are a few other beverages that pair well with grilled shrimp tacos. A light and refreshing beer, such as a Mexican lager, is a great option. This beer has a crisp and clean flavor that can complement the flavors of the dish. Another great option is a margarita, which has a citrusy flavor that can balance out the spiciness of the dish.

The History and Evolution of Grilled Shrimp Tacos

Grilled shrimp tacos have become a popular dish in many restaurants and households across the world. This delicious meal is a combination of fresh shrimp, grilled to perfection, and a variety of toppings and sauces, all wrapped in a soft tortilla. But where did this dish originate, and how has it evolved over time?

The history of grilled shrimp tacos can be traced back to Mexico, where seafood has always been a staple in coastal regions. Shrimp, in particular, has been a popular ingredient in Mexican cuisine for centuries. However, the concept of wrapping shrimp in a tortilla and grilling it is a relatively new development.

The first recorded instance of grilled shrimp tacos can be found in the Baja California region of Mexico in the 1960s. This area is known for its fresh seafood, and it was here that chefs began experimenting with different ways to prepare shrimp. Grilling the shrimp and serving it in a tortilla was a simple yet delicious way to showcase the natural flavors of the seafood.

As the popularity of grilled shrimp tacos grew, so did the variety of toppings and sauces used to enhance the dish. In the early days, the tacos were typically served with a simple salsa or guacamole. However, as the dish spread to other regions, chefs began to experiment with different flavors and ingredients.

Today, grilled shrimp tacos can be found with a wide range of toppings, including shredded cabbage, pico de gallo, sour cream, and various types of cheese. Some chefs even add fruit, such as mango or pineapple, to give the tacos a sweet and tangy flavor.

In addition to the toppings, the type of tortilla used in grilled shrimp tacos has also evolved over time. While traditional corn tortillas are still popular, many restaurants now offer flour tortillas as well. Some chefs even use unique types of tortillas, such as spinach or tomato-flavored, to add an extra layer of flavor to the dish.

Another factor that has contributed to the evolution of grilled shrimp tacos is the rise of fusion cuisine. Chefs around the world have begun to incorporate elements of Mexican cuisine into their own dishes, resulting in unique and delicious variations of the classic taco.

For example, some chefs have added Asian flavors to grilled shrimp tacos, such as soy sauce or sesame oil. Others have incorporated Mediterranean ingredients, such as feta cheese or tzatziki sauce. These fusion tacos offer a new twist on the traditional dish, while still maintaining the core elements of grilled shrimp and a soft tortilla.

Q&A

1. What are grilled shrimp tacos?
Grilled shrimp tacos are a type of taco that features grilled shrimp as the main protein, along with various toppings and seasonings.

2. What ingredients are typically used in grilled shrimp tacos?
Ingredients commonly used in grilled shrimp tacos include shrimp, tortillas, avocado, lime, cilantro, red onion, jalapeno, and various spices and seasonings.

3. How are grilled shrimp tacos prepared?
To prepare grilled shrimp tacos, the shrimp are typically marinated in a mixture of spices and seasonings, then grilled until cooked through. The tortillas are heated, and the shrimp are then placed on top along with various toppings and seasonings.

4. Are grilled shrimp tacos healthy?
Grilled shrimp tacos can be a healthy option, as shrimp is a low-calorie, high-protein food that is also a good source of omega-3 fatty acids. However, the overall healthiness of the dish will depend on the specific ingredients and preparation methods used.

5. What are some variations of grilled shrimp tacos?
Variations of grilled shrimp tacos can include different toppings and seasonings, such as mango salsa, chipotle mayo, or cabbage slaw. They can also be served with different types of tortillas, such as corn or flour tortillas.
